The overview below groups typical House Powerwashing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Longmeadow,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
House Powerwashing Cost - The typical cost for house powerwashing ranges from $250 to $600, depending on the size and condition of the property. Larger homes or heavily soiled exteriors may cost more, with prices reaching around $700 in some cases.
Per Square Foot Pricing - Powerwashing services are often priced per square foot, generally between $0.15 and $0.35. For example, cleaning a 2,000-square-foot house might cost approximately $300 to $700.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for specialized cleaning or difficult-to-reach areas, adding $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the complexity of the job and specific property features.
Estimate Variability - Costs can vary significantly based on geographic location, contractor rates, and property specifics.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to individual properties in Longmeadow, MA, and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can be cleaned with house powerwashing? House powerwashing can effectively clean surfaces such as siding, decks, driveways, sidewalks, and fences to improve appearance and remove dirt or grime.
Is house powerwashing safe for my home’s exterior? When performed by experienced professionals, house powerwashing is generally safe and can help maintain the integrity of your home’s exterior materials.
How often should exterior house powerwashing be done? The frequency of powerwashing depends on local conditions and the home's exposure to elements, but typically once a year or as needed is recommended.
What should I do to prepare my home for powerwashing? Homeowners should remove outdoor furniture, cover delicate plants, and ensure access to all areas to facilitate thorough cleaning by service providers.
